
Potter stars discuss new flick
Daniel Radcliffe and his co-stars have been speaking about Harry Potter as a new film and the seventh book are set for a release.
In the movie Harry Potter and the Order of the Phoenix, the boy wizard is in his fifth year at Hogwarts, battling the Ministry of Magic who refuse to believe that the evil Lord Voldemort has been restored to life.
But these days, the Potter crew have all grown and up - especially Daniel, who's moved onto new ventures such as starring in the West End.
When asked at a press conference if recently going naked in Equus was more complicated than kissing co-star Katie Leung in the new movie, he said: "Being naked was possibly not as complicated - although belt buckles can give everyone a bit of trouble at times!
"It's probably a dull answer because it's the one everyone would expect. Kissing Katie was a very very comfortable experience, especially when compared to being naked on stage. And blinding horses."
The final book Harry Potter and the Deathly Hallows is being released two days before Radcliffe's 18th birthday on the 21st July, and in it fans will discover the fate of the magical gang.
Harry Potter and the Order of the Phoenix hits cinemas nationwide on July 12.
